Win11/Win10双系统党的福音用VMware虚拟机无损体验Ubuntu再也不怕搞崩主机了对于许多Windows用户来说Linux系统总是带着一层神秘面纱。你想尝试Ubuntu的强大命令行工具又担心安装双系统会搞乱硬盘分区你想学习Docker容器技术却害怕配置环境时把主机系统弄得一团糟。现在VMware虚拟机为你提供了完美的解决方案——一个完全隔离的Linux沙盒环境让你可以尽情探索而无需承担任何风险。1. 为什么选择虚拟机而非双系统传统双系统安装需要划分磁盘分区存在数据丢失风险且切换系统必须重启电脑。而虚拟机方案具有以下不可替代的优势零风险隔离虚拟机中的操作不会影响主机系统即使Ubuntu崩溃也只需重启虚拟机无缝切换Windows和Ubuntu可同时运行通过快捷键自由切换快照回滚安装软件出错一键恢复到之前的系统状态资源可控可动态调整CPU、内存等资源分配跨平台共享虚拟机文件可轻松迁移到其他电脑提示即使是8GB内存的笔记本分配2-4GB给Ubuntu也能获得流畅体验现代虚拟化技术已非常高效。2. VMware环境配置最佳实践2.1 硬件准备与性能优化在创建虚拟机前建议进行以下准备工作磁盘空间至少预留40GB空间Ubuntu系统开发环境内存分配8GB主机内存建议分配3-4GB16GB主机内存建议分配6-8GBCPU核心为虚拟机分配2-4个CPU核心# 查看Windows主机资源使用情况管理员权限运行 systeminfo | find 可用物理内存 wmic cpu get NumberOfCores,NumberOfLogicalProcessors2.2 网络模式选择指南VMware提供多种网络连接方式各有适用场景模式特点适用场景NAT虚拟机共享主机IP主机充当路由器常规上网、下载软件桥接虚拟机获取独立局域网IP需要被局域网其他设备访问仅主机虚拟机与主机私有网络完全隔离的安全测试环境推荐方案日常使用选择NAT模式需要搭建服务器时切换为桥接模式。3. Ubuntu安装与初始配置3.1 创建优化型虚拟机在VMware中新建虚拟机时注意以下关键设置选择稍后安装操作系统客户机操作系统选择Linux → Ubuntu 64位磁盘类型选择SCSI推荐虚拟磁盘拆分成多个文件便于迁移1. 点击自定义硬件 2. 显存设置为2GB如需图形界面 3. 开启3D图形加速 4. 取消勾选打印机等无用设备3.2 Ubuntu安装注意事项安装Ubuntu时建议选择最小安装节省空间取消自动更新避免后台占用资源分区方案选择使用整个磁盘时区设置为Shanghai中国用户注意首次启动后立即安装VMware Tools可获得更好的显示效果和文件共享功能。4. 高效使用虚拟机的进阶技巧4.1 主机与虚拟机无缝协作实现Windows与Ubuntu高效协同的三种方式共享文件夹在VMware设置中创建共享目录Ubuntu中通过/mnt/hgfs访问剪贴板共享安装open-vm-tools启用双向复制粘贴拖放文件在VMware设置中启用拖放功能# 在Ubuntu中挂载共享文件夹 sudo mkdir /mnt/share sudo vmhgfs-fuse .host:/share /mnt/share -o allow_other4.2 快照管理与系统维护合理使用快照可以极大提升工作效率黄金快照安装完系统后立即创建阶段快照每完成一个重要配置就创建一个恢复策略小问题回退到上一个快照大问题恢复到黄金快照快照命名规范示例20230820_初始安装 20230821_配置开发环境 20230822_部署项目A5. 将Ubuntu虚拟机变为开发利器5.1 开发环境配置针对不同开发者推荐以下配置Web开发者安装VS Code配置Node.js环境安装Docker CE# 安装Docker sudo apt update sudo apt install docker.io sudo systemctl enable --now docker数据科学家配置Python虚拟环境安装Jupyter Notebook部署CUDA工具包如需GPU加速5.2 性能调优技巧提升虚拟机运行效率的实用方法关闭Ubuntu动画效果gsettings set org.gnome.desktop.interface enable-animations false使用轻量级桌面环境如Xfce定期清理缓存sudo apt autoremove sudo apt clean调整swappiness值建议10-30echo vm.swappiness20 | sudo tee -a /etc/sysctl.conf sudo sysctl -p经过这些优化即使是配置普通的电脑Ubuntu虚拟机也能流畅运行大多数开发工具。我在团队内部推广这套方案后新人Linux上手时间缩短了60%而且再没有出现过因为误操作导致主机系统崩溃的情况。